Adopt Daisy

Mixed Breed · Female

Female Date of Birth: November 2010 Weight: Medium Spayed She is Daisy, a cat whose gaze reads loneliness and sadness that she carries in her heart. Though she wishes for a friend who will offer love and sustenance, she is afraid to approach people. She needs someone to show her that not all people are the same and that there are warm souls who can offer her a happy life in the shelter of a loving family. Click here for more photos. Contact:

An adult dog fits most household rhythms once the first couple of weeks of adjustment pass. Two reasonable walks a day plus play time is usually enough. Plan a "decompression fortnight" — quiet routine, no visitors, no off-leash adventures — to let them settle.

🇷🇴Adopting from Romania

Romanian rescues handle the highest volume of cross-border adoptions in the EU. Animals are quarantined and fully vetted before transport. Reputable rescues maintain detailed health records and post-adoption follow-up.

Can I adopt Daisy if I live in another country?
Yes, in most cases. Rescues across Europe routinely place animals abroad — Asociatia ROBI / 4animals.ro will tell you what they need (EU pet passport, rabies titer, transport coordination) and whether they handle transport themselves or refer you to a partner. Plan for an extra €100–€350 in transport costs depending on distance.
